Aimed at novice and professional garden designers, this specification `workshop’ explains a method of producing instructions for garden design work which can be tailored to an individual designer’s current project.

The model specification has been developed over many years and is thoroughly tried and tested. It has been kept deliberately brief and is flexible enough to allow designers to expand or condense it to suit their needs, and to allow use of their favourite products and plants.

Students and newly-qualified garden designers will find the model specification useful both as a contract document and as a technical check-list; it can be used on the smallest projects where the specification clauses are annotated directly on drawings or plans. In addition to the advice on the writing of specifications, examples of draft letters are included which may be used or adapted during the tendering phases of a project.

The format of the pages in this book has the model clauses on the right-hand side of the relevant page, with advice, reminders and other comments to the left. The clauses themselves are also reproduced on CD-ROM so that they may be downloaded by designers for their own adaptation and uses.

The overall format assumes a designer is acting as an independent consultant and not as an employee or partner of a contractor offering a package design and build service.

84 pages; spiral-bound with CD-ROM of clauses only.
